Allier

Definition: to combine, unite, match, ally

Il faut allier nos efforts - We need to combine our efforts.

Il va s'allier avec tes parents - He's going to ally himself with your parents.

Related: une alliance - alliance, union; allié (adj) allied

Pronunciation: [a lyay] Audio Link
